MongoDB Development

Build Faster with Flexible Document Databases

MongoDB's document model matches how developers think about data. No rigid schemas, no JOIN complexity — just natural JSON documents that evolve with your application. We build and optimise MongoDB deployments that scale effortlessly.

MongoDB 7.xAtlasAggregation PipelineChange StreamsAtlas SearchMongoose ORM
40k+GitHub Stars
v7.0Latest Stable
ForbesUses MongoDB
175M+Downloads
60+MongoDB Projects

WHY MONGODB

Why We Use MongoDB in Production

Trusted by thousands of companies worldwide, MongoDB delivers the performance, scalability, and developer experience that modern applications demand.

Flexible Document Model

Store data as JSON-like documents — no rigid schema, no migrations for every new field. Iterate your data model as fast as you iterate your code.

Horizontal Scalability

MongoDB's native sharding distributes data across clusters automatically — scaling to petabytes and millions of operations per second with linear cost growth.

Atlas Search Built In

Full-text search, faceting, fuzzy matching, and vector search are built directly into MongoDB Atlas — no Elasticsearch cluster to manage.

Real-Time Change Streams

Change streams provide a real-time event feed of every database change — perfect for triggering webhooks, syncing caches, or building event-driven architectures.

Geospatial Queries

Native 2dsphere indexes support complex geospatial queries — find nearby locations, calculate distances, and filter by geographic regions efficiently.

Aggregation Pipeline

MongoDB's powerful aggregation pipeline handles complex analytics, data transformations, and multi-stage processing directly in the database layer.

Schema Design & Modelling

Optimised data architecture from day one

DATABASE DESIGN

MongoDB Schema Design & Architecture

We design well-structured MongoDB schemas tailored to your access patterns — with optimal indexing, partitioning, and query strategies that keep performance high as data grows.

  • Data modelling & entity relationships
  • Index strategy & performance tuning
  • Migrations & version-controlled schema changes
  • Replication, clustering & high availability
  • Backup, recovery & disaster planning

DBA & Managed Services

Ongoing administration & monitoring

DATABASE ADMINISTRATION

Managed MongoDB Services

Our DBA team handles everything — performance monitoring, slow query analysis, security audits, automated backups, and version upgrades so you can focus on building features.

  • 24/7 performance monitoring & alerting
  • Automated backup & point-in-time recovery
  • Security hardening & access control audits
  • Cloud migration (AWS / GCP / Azure)
  • Zero-downtime version upgrades

OUR PROCESS

How We Set Up Your MongoDB Database

01

Discovery

Requirements & data access pattern analysis

02

Design

Schema modelling, indexing & HA planning

03

Build

Setup, seeding, migrations & integration

04

Optimise

Query profiling, index tuning & load testing

05

Operate

Monitoring, backups & ongoing DBA support

Need a Robust MongoDB Database?

Get a free database consultation with our experts. No commitment required.

Get a Free Consultation